Shenzhen Microbiao Precision Hardware Co., Ltd.
$32.00
Min. Order: 2 pieces
Easy Return
70 orders
$32.00
Min. Order: 2 pieces
Easy Return
55 orders
$32.00
Min. Order: 2 pieces
Easy Return
39 orders
$22.00
Min. Order: 2 pieces
Easy Return
102 orders
$22.00
Min. Order: 2 pieces
Easy Return
10 orders
$22.00
Min. Order: 2 pieces
Easy Return
182 orders
$22.00
Min. Order: 2 pieces
Easy Return
40 orders
$22.00
Min. Order: 2 pieces
Easy Return
8 orders